Meet Our Compassionate Therapist

Sara McCullough, LCSW

Sara McCullough is a Licensed Clinical Social Worker and U.S. Navy veteran specializing in trauma-focused therapy for individuals who are ready to move beyond simply coping with the past. She has extensive experience working with survivors of abuse, interpersonal violence, military-related trauma, and other distressing life experiences.

Sara is trained in Accelerated Resolution Therapy (ART), Eye-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R) and other trauma-informed approaches designed to help clients process painful memories, reduce emotional and physical reactions to trauma, and create meaningful change. Her experience as both a clinician and military veteran gives her a unique understanding of trauma, resilience, and the impact that difficult experiences can have long after the event itself has ended.

Through Trauma Intensive Therapy Packages, Sara offers clients the opportunity to dedicate focused, uninterrupted time to their healing rather than limiting trauma work to traditional weekly sessions. Her approach is compassionate, collaborative, and focused on helping clients address the experiences that continue to keep them feeling stuck so they can move forward with greater peace and confidence.
